Court jails mason over stolen burglarproof bars

An Area Court in Jos on Friday sentenced a mason, Kayimu Bakam, 39, to one-month imprisonment over stolen burglarproof bars.
Judge Daniel Damulak sentenced the convict after he pleaded guilty to possessing stolen property and begged the court for leniency.
The judge gave the convict an option of a N5,000 fine.
Prosecution counsel Ibrahim Gowkat told the court that the case was reported at the ‘A’ Division Police station on September 9 by PC Friday Idowu.
He said the constable brought him to the station when he could not explain how he got the burglarproof bars.
The prosecutor further told the court that during the police investigation, the accused confessed that he bought the burglarproof bars from an unknown person.
